Who should attend
Auditors who are not native speakers of English but need to conduct their audits in English.
About the course
You will discover how to write a clear, coherent audit report in fluent English. The course focuses on a structure for writing up observations that will enable you to maximise audit viewpoint. You will become familiar with strategies that will help you be as concise as possible and improve readability. You will communicate greater value to your readers.
Contents
Day 1
- Knowing your target audience
- Overview of in-house written documents
- Writing and presenting written material
- English language tips: appropriate structure, false friends and inappropriate translations
- Using appropriate internal audit and in-house terminology
- Writing exercises
- Paragraph structure
- Using tables and graphs in order to present findings
Day 2
- Audit rating scales and opinions with translations for readers
- Writing clear, concise executive summaries
- Using language effectively in PowerPoint presentations
- Reviewing and revising internal audit reports
- Drawing up an individual written English-language action plan
- Individual feedback on participants written documents
Methodology
Interactive lecture, discussion, individual and group exercises, case studies
